Cons

Lack of autonomy across the board. You’re not trusted to own your work, and everything is over-processed without actually being thought through. Leadership is easily the worst I’ve experienced. There is zero clarity, no real long-term strategy (despite the word being thrown around constantly), and decisions change at any moment. For context, there was a 2.5-hour marketing meeting in January focused on 2026 goals that hasn’t even been approved.... we are halfway into April now. You spend the majority of your time building decks. Sometimes up to 10 at once, only for them to disappear into a black hole with no follow-up, no decisions, and no acknowledgment. There’s also a very strange internal culture where people genuinely don’t seem to like or respect each other, which makes collaboration difficult and the overall environment uncomfortable.
